    Re MOTs etc

    Best plan is to respect your local guys in a local garage.

    They recognise a fair customer & give you a fair price for work that needs doing.

    If you go to rip off places and treat them a bit disdainful, they rip you off

    Agreed, also if you maintain your car you should have no surprises on your MOT,
    act on any advisories, check your lights, tyres etc regularly and don't ignore any unusual noises, they are your early warnings, rarely does anything on a car fail without prior notice, if you ignore them they will come back to bite you on the bum! usually at the most inconvienient time!:cool:
